What This Setup Does
This GoHighLevel setup allows you to:
- Track your main product and each upsell separately
- Track total revenue across all products at the same time
- See how tests, campaigns, and traffic sources impact each step of your funnel
- Get a clear, holistic view of what’s working — and what’s not
This level of insight is what makes smarter scaling decisions possible.
Step 1: Create Webhooks in Visiopt
1. Settings page > Payment Processing and carts
2. Select Go High Level:
3. Create one webhook for each main product and upsell you wish to track individually. Plus create one additional webhook and name it Total Revenue
Webhook | Purpose |
Webhook 1 | Product A Revenue |
Webhook 2 | Product B Revenue |
Webhook 3 | Product C Revenue |
Webhook 4 | Total Revenue (All Product (A,B and C)) |
4. Should look something like this when done:
This setup allows you to:
- See performance for each product and upsell separately
- Track total revenue across the entire funnel at the same time
Step 2: Add All Webhooks to the GoHighLevel Workflow
1. Login GoHighLevel > Dashboard > Workflow
2. Go to Automation in the left side bar
3. Click Create Workflow
4. Select the Trigger Webhook (Purchase / Order Submitted / Payment Received)

6. Add a Webhook action for each Visiopt webhook you created
7. Select Webhook as the action type
8. Select Method: POST
9. Paste each Visiopt Webhook URL, one at a time
10. Save the action
11. Repeat these steps for each Visiopt webhook you created (product-level and total revenue).
When a purchase occurs, all webhooks will fire together.
This is expected and required. Each webhook serves a different purpose — individual product tracking and total revenue tracking — giving you a complete and accurate view of performance.
Note: If your main product and upsell products are in separate GoHighLevel workflows, be sure to add each webhook to its appropriate workflow.
Step 3: Set Up Visiopt Rules (Important)
This step ensures revenue is recorded correctly for each product and for your funnel as a whole.
Product-Specific Webhooks
For each product or upsell webhook:
- Add a Product filter rule
- Select the matching product for that webhook
This ensures each webhook only counts revenue for that specific product.
Example:
Webhook | Rule Required |
Product A | Filter By Product A |
Product B | Filter By Product B |
Product C | Filter By Product C |
To set up rules, check the Webhook Rule checkbox:
From the first dropdown, select "order['productName']" From the second dropdown, select Includes In the third field, enter the product name:
Do the same for each product!

Total Revenue Webhook (Critical)
- The Total Revenue webhook does not use any filters
- It automatically collects revenue from all products
Important: Be sure to add the Total Revenue webhook to all workflows (main order workflow and any upsell workflows).
This is what allows Visiopt to show accurate total revenue across your entire funnel.
Step 4: Partial Product Revenue (Special Case)
Use this option only if your workflow contains products you do not want included in total revenue reporting.
Scenario
- Your workflow includes 5 products
- You only want to track revenue from 3 of them
What to Do
- Add product filter rules to the Total Revenue webhook
- Select only the products you want included
This ensures total revenue reflects only the selected products.
Step 5: Multiple Workflows (Main Sale + Upsell)
Use this setup when your funnel is split across workflows.
Scenario
- Main Sale → Workflow 1
- Upsell(s) → Workflow 2
- You want the combined revenue from both
Setup Steps
- Create one common Total Revenue webhook in Visiopt
- Add this same webhook URL to:
- Main Sale Workflow
- Upsell Workflow
- No rules are required on the Visiopt side (only revenue-related products exist)
Visiopt will automatically combine revenue from both workflows into a single, accurate total.

Final Notes
- Do not remove or rename webhooks after launch without checking with the Visiopt team
- Always test with a real or $1 purchase to confirm setup
- If new products or upsells are added later, create new product-level webhooks
- Ensure the Total Revenue webhook remains active across all revenue workflows
